TWO CORINTHIAN BLACK-FIGURED VESSELS
Circa Early 6th Century B.C.
One an alabastron with a swan facing left with its enormous wings outstretched, a petalled rosette on the base and mouth, small rosettes in the field, vertical lines on the neck and a row of dots on the rim, details in added red; and one an amphora with a band on the body with a goat facing a lion, a swan behind them, the field filled with dots and rosettes, with thin bands above and below, tongues on the shoulder, zig-zag on the neck
5.1 in. (13 cm) high for the taller (2)
